Marquis Who's Who Honors Danny Demis Cordova for Management Expertise

UNIONDALE, NY / ACCESS Newswire / November 12, 2025 / Marquis Who's Who honors Danny Demis Cordova for his expertise in management as the owner of The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In. With more than 15 years of experience in his current role, Mr. Cordova strives to support his parents' legacy by maintaining long-term business operations. By continuing this community fixture, he aims to create a lasting, positive impact.

The Beginnings of a Family Legacy

Before Mr. Cordova was born, his mother landed a job at The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In in 1967. As the story goes, she entered the restaurant and found that the owner was not doing well. He asked if she wanted to take over his business and she accepted. Paying about $2,500 to purchase the business, Mr. Cordova's mother began running The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In.

Early Involvement in the Business

When Mr. Cordova was about 10 years old, his parents' business started to grow. Though he had been involved in the business for most of his life, Mr. Cordova did not officially begin working in the restaurant until he was 12. During this time, his family saw significant success, but simultaneously became busy with the demanding responsibilities of management.

Mr. Cordova's mother passed away in 2009, after reaching the age of 100. Though he felt her loss deeply, he also recognized that the business needed his attention. The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In had grown, but the demands of that growth led to certain areas of neglect. The old building needed to be replaced, and the parking lot redone. Under his leadership, the restaurant was restored.

Restoring The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In

Mr. Cordova rebuilt The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In in the corner of the property, created a parking area in the front and added new indoor and outdoor dining patios for the restaurant. Today, he oversees the continued growth of The Original Chubby's Burger Drive-In, as well as 40-45 employees. His goal is simple: to keep people happy and help his community.
